What Type A and Type B mean
Type A
Violations of licensing requirements that, if not corrected, have a direct and immediate risk to the health, safety, or personal rights of persons in care.
Type B
Violations of licensing requirements that, without correction, could become a risk to the health, safety, or personal rights of persons in care.

Both classifications are published by California CDSS and are shown as published. SeniorLivingFacts does not rename them or add a severity level of its own.

Inspection
Licensing and administrationType A
Official classification
Type A
Official code
1569.618(c)(3)
Regulation authority
HSC

What the official deficiency says

(c)The facility shall employ, and the administrator shall schedule, a sufficient number of staff members to do all of the following: (3) Ensure that at least one staff member who has c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) training and first aid training is on duty and on the premises at all times. This paragraph shall not be construed to require staff to provide CPR. This requirement is not met as evidenced by: Deficient Practice Statement Based on record review,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in 3 out of the 3 staff present CPR had expire in July 2024, which poses an immediate health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.

Official plan of correction

POC Due Date: 09/11/2024 Plan of Correction House Manager stated they will enroll into a CPR class. House manager also stated they will be sending confirmation of enrollment and will be sending a copy of completion to LPA.

Plan of correction recorded
Correction not verified in available records
View official report

Fire safety and emergency preparednessType B
Official classification
Type B
Official code
1569.695(c)
Regulation authority
HSC

What the official deficiency says

(c) A facility shall conduct a drill at least quarterly for each shift. The type of emergency covered in a drill shall vary from quarter to quarter, taking into account different emergency scenarios. An actual evacuation of residents is not required during a drill. While a facility may provide an opportunity for residents to participate in a drill, it shall not require any resident participation. Documentation of the drills shall include the date, the type of emergency covered by the drill, and the names of staff participating in the drill. This requirement is not met as evidenced by: Deficient Practice Statement Based onrecord review the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in which poses/posed a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.

Official plan of correction

POC Due Date: 09/17/2024 Plan of Correction House Manager stated they will conducting/documenting facility’s drills and will be sending a copy to LPA.

Plan of correction recorded
Correction not verified in available records
View official report
